## Add audio waveform preview to clip editor

This PR adds a rendered waveform preview to the Tonefield clip editor. Peaks are computed in a worker and cached per asset, so scrubbing stays responsive on long recordings. Downsampling uses a fixed bucket strategy rather than adaptive zoom, which keeps render times predictable for the release build. No migration needed; the cache is rebuilt lazily. For QA sign-off, the relevant tuning constants are listed below.

tuning constants:
QUOTAS = {
    "druwyn": 5,
    "holix": 5,
    "zorath": 5,
    "holwyn": 10,
}

## Service Accounts — Poolkeeper

svc-poolkeeper owns the shared Postgres pools for the Bramblevale cluster. Pool size: 40 per node, hard cap 200. If connections saturate, check svc-poolkeeper first — it leaks when the Drift sidecar restarts mid-transaction. Do not recycle the account mid-incident; drain pools via the Harrowgate console instead. Auth to the pool manager's internal API uses a static key, rotated monthly by the platform team. Current key for svc-poolkeeper is below.

API key for tagef-fafop: vxb2-ta

All changes to timezone conversion logic in Skerryline's export pipeline require explicit approval before release. This covers DST boundary handling, the tenant-level `default_tz` override, and the UTC-normalization step applied to scheduled exports. Release managers should confirm that the golden-file test suite for ambiguous timestamps passes on both the spring-forward and fall-back fixtures, and that the approval record is attached to the release ticket. Approval authority for this area rests with a single named owner.

account owner for kafop-haweg: Pelax Gilael Istir